Output 4091b35f0fa066f2b990e4477b56e8c6e0278b2a412fffe529cdb2b771539901:1

value
26308579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a4bc8238419f158e70a30cbd8b55480c9b5c65 OP_EQUAL
address
3MAfCVBc8DoiSoZibrwV9hFAFBZYBCBiB6
transaction
4091b35f0fa066f2b990e4477b56e8c6e0278b2a412fffe529cdb2b771539901
confirmations
460959
spent
true